Photography Seminar with National Geographic Photographer, Mattias Klum
Saturday, 3 July 2010, 10.00 am to 12.00 pm
Ngee Ann Auditorium, Basement
Asian Civilisations Museum
In this exculsive photography seminar, held in conjunction with Month of Photography Asia 2010 and the exhibition The testament of Tebaran: Borneo's Moment of Truth at the Asian Civilisations Museum, acclaimed National Geographic photographer, Mattias Klum will share the art of storytelling through photography.
He will focus on concepts, compositions and techniques to produce great photographs and stories that editors look for. Participants will learn about photographing wildlife and dealing with extreme conditions.
